1. The Lip Sync Challenge
Lip sync challenges have become hugely popular, and they’re an absolute blast to do with friends over video chat. Whether you’re pretending to be your favorite pop star or simply enjoying a funny song, the lip sync challenge is all about showing off your performance skills. The person who can make the best dramatic gestures and perform the song with the most flair wins!
How to Play:
- Pick a song and perform a lip sync rendition of it.
- You can use props, costumes, or just your best facial expressions to enhance the performance.
- After each performance, vote for the most entertaining act.
2. Emoji Story Challenge
The Emoji Story Challenge is perfect for friends who love a good puzzle and enjoy getting creative. In this challenge, one person has to create a story using only emojis, and the other person or group has to guess what the story is. You can use the chat feature on video platforms to send your emoji story, and the guesses will keep everyone engaged and entertained.
How to Play:
- One person sends a series of emojis that tell a story.
- The others have to guess what the story is.
- The person who guesses the most stories correctly wins!
3. Guess the Song Challenge
This one is a great challenge for music lovers! In the Guess the Song Challenge, one person hums, sings, or taps a beat of a popular song, and the others have to guess which song it is. The twist is that you can’t sing the lyrics; you have to find creative ways to get your friends to figure it out.
How to Play:
- One player hums, taps, or beats out a song without saying the lyrics.
- The other players try to guess the song title.
- The player who guesses the most songs correctly wins.
4. The “Don’t Laugh” Challenge
Who doesn’t love a good laugh? The “Don’t Laugh” challenge is all about keeping a straight face while your friends do everything in their power to make you laugh. It could be jokes, funny faces, or ridiculous antics – anything goes! This challenge is sure to leave everyone in stitches, even if they lose.
How to Play:
- One person tries to make everyone laugh by doing silly things (telling jokes, making faces, etc.).
- Everyone else tries not to laugh.
- If you laugh, you’re out of the round.
- The last person who hasn’t laughed wins.
5. Who’s That Celebrity?
For fans of movies, TV shows, and pop culture, this challenge is perfect. One person acts out the character or celebrity of their choice, while the others guess who it is. The key is to make your performance as exaggerated and fun as possible to throw your friends off track and keep them guessing.
How to Play:
- One player acts like a famous character or celebrity.
- The others have to guess who it is.
- You can use props or costumes to make the performance more convincing.
- The first person to guess correctly gets the point.
6. Draw It Challenge
This drawing challenge is simple yet hilarious. The person gives the group a random object or scenario to draw, and everyone has a limited time (say, 30 seconds or a minute) to complete their drawings. The results are usually comical and make for great conversation starters afterward.
How to Play:
- One person gives an object or scenario to draw (e.g., “draw a giraffe on a skateboard”).
- Set a timer for 30 seconds to a minute for everyone to draw.
- After time’s up, everyone shows their drawings, and the group votes on the funniest or most creative one.
7. Virtual Scavenger Hunt
A virtual scavenger hunt is a high-energy game that gets everyone moving. One person will call out a list of items or challenges to find, and the players must race to retrieve them from their homes as quickly as possible. It’s an interactive way to keep the challenge fun and get your adrenaline pumping.
How to Play:
- One person creates a list of items or challenges (e.g., “find something red” or “do a cartwheel”).
- Players have a limited amount of time to find the items or complete the challenges.
- The person who finds the most items or completes the most challenges wins.
8. Two Truths and a Lie
This classic game is perfect for getting to know your friends better, and it works especially well over video chat. Each player takes turns sharing three statements about themselves: two are true, and one is a lie. The other players have to guess which statement is the lie. It’s a fun and often hilarious way to learn quirky facts about your friends.
How to Play:
- One person shares three statements about themselves (two true, one false).
- The other players try to guess which statement is the lie.
- After everyone guesses, the person reveals the lie.
- The person who guesses the most lies correctly wins.
9. The Accent Challenge
The Accent Challenge is all about trying your best (or worst!) to mimic different accents. Choose a region or country, and take turns trying to speak in that accent. The fun comes from how offbeat your impersonations can get. You can even add the challenge of speaking in a particular accent for an entire sentence or phrase!
How to Play:
- One person chooses an accent (e.g., British, Australian, French).
- Players take turns speaking in that accent.
- The group votes on the most convincing (or funniest!) accent.
